High-Ticket Models You Can Use
Each model has its perks and style.
High-Ticket Direct Sales
This is the most basic model.
Think online courses, special gear, or software people already want.
It’s quick and effective.
Model #2: The Webinar Model
You invite people to watch a video about the product.
You don’t have to run the webinar yourself—the company does it.
Webinar models work well for complex or expensive items.
Phone Call High-Ticket Model
Some high-ticket products need a personal touch.
It’s perfect for sales over $2,000—like coaching or business solutions.
All you do is help people see the value, then let the pros close the sale.
Model #4: The Application Model
Here, people apply before they can buy.
If they qualify, they get a call or invitation to buy.
It makes the offer feel special and exclusive.
Mix-and-Match High-Ticket Model
You can pick the part you like best.
You can invite them to a video, then a call, or straight to an application.
If you’re not sure where to start, hybrid models let you test different ways until you find your sweet spot.
